ya.make 826 B

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647
  1. # Generated by devtools/yamaker from nixpkgs 22.11.
  2. LIBRARY()
  3. LICENSE(
  4. BSL-1.0 AND
  5. CC0-1.0
  6. )
  7. LICENSE_TEXTS(.yandex_meta/licenses.list.txt)
  8. VERSION(1.86.0)
  9. ORIGINAL_SOURCE(https://github.com/boostorg/container/archive/boost-1.86.0.tar.gz)
  10. PEERDIR(
  11. contrib/restricted/boost/assert
  12. contrib/restricted/boost/config
  13. contrib/restricted/boost/intrusive
  14. contrib/restricted/boost/move
  15. )
  16. ADDINCL(
  17. GLOBAL contrib/restricted/boost/container/include
  18. )
  19. NO_COMPILER_WARNINGS()
  20. NO_UTIL()
  21. IF (DYNAMIC_BOOST)
  22. CFLAGS(
  23. GLOBAL -DBOOST_CONTAINER_DYN_LINK
  24. )
  25. ENDIF()
  26. SRCS(
  27. src/alloc_lib.c
  28. src/dlmalloc.cpp
  29. src/global_resource.cpp
  30. src/monotonic_buffer_resource.cpp
  31. src/pool_resource.cpp
  32. src/synchronized_pool_resource.cpp
  33. src/unsynchronized_pool_resource.cpp
  34. )
  35. END()